Why Choose DHL for International Shipping?
Before diving into the label generation process, it’s worth noting why DHL is a preferred choice for international shipping:
- Global Reach: DHL operates in over 220 countries and territories.
- Speed and Reliability: Known for its fast delivery services, especially for express shipments.
- Customs Expertise: DHL provides support and tools to handle customs documentation smoothly.
- Real-Time Tracking: Customers and sellers can monitor shipments every step of the way.
Steps to Generate a DHL Shipping Label for International Orders
1. Create a DHL Account
To start generating shipping labels, you need a DHL Express or DHL eCommerce account. You can sign up directly on the DHL website or through an integrated shipping platform.
- Visit dhl.com
- Choose the service relevant to your business (DHL Express or DHL eCommerce)
- Complete the registration process
2. Gather Shipment Information
Accurate and complete information is crucial when shipping internationally. Be prepared with the following details:
- Sender’s and recipient’s full address (including postal codes and phone numbers)
- Package weight and dimensions
- Shipment contents and declared value
- Harmonized System (HS) codes for customs
- Invoice details for customs clearance
3. Use DHL’s Label Generation Tools
DHL provides several ways to generate shipping labels:
a. DHL Express MyDHL+
- Log in to your MyDHL+ dashboard
- Select “Create a Shipment”
- Enter shipment details, select services, and input customs information
- Print the shipping label and attach it securely to the package
b. DHL eCommerce Portal
- Ideal for high-volume eCommerce sellers
- Import orders or input shipment data manually
- Generate and print labels with tracking numbers
c. Third-Party Integrations
Many platforms like Shopify, WooCommerce, ShipStation, and Easyship integrate with DHL. These allow you to automate label creation, update tracking, and manage multiple orders in one place.
Best Practices for DHL International Shipping Labels
1. Ensure Label Clarity
Print labels using a thermal or high-resolution printer. Avoid faded prints as they can cause scanning issues.
2. Attach Commercial Invoice
Include at least three copies of the commercial invoice along with your shipment. This is mandatory for customs clearance.
3. Use Proper Packaging
Follow DHL’s packaging guidelines to prevent damage. Securely affix the label to the largest flat surface of the package.
4. Check for Restricted Items
Review DHL’s list of restricted and prohibited items for the destination country to avoid shipment delays.
5. Track Your Shipment
Once the label is generated and the package is picked up, you can track it using the provided tracking number on DHL’s website.
Common Errors to Avoid
- Incorrect Address Format: Different countries have different formatting rules; always double-check.
- Wrong HS Code: This can lead to customs delays or extra charges.
- Underdeclaring Value: Always declare the correct value to avoid fines or penalties.
- Not Including Required Documentation: Missing commercial invoices or permits can result in shipment holds.
